Freediving is also called skin diving and is an extreme sport which does not require specialised equipment. The art of a free dive relies mainly on the diver's ability to hold his breath for long durations without the aid of any breathing apparatus. Expert divers are known to dive as deep as scuba divers, and free diving is considered extremely freeing due to the lack of cumbersome equipment.
